Q1: Why is window count important in BTU calculation?
A: Windows are significant sources of heat transfer. Each window adds approximately 1000 BTU to account for heat gain/loss.
Q2: How does occupancy affect BTU requirements?
A: Each person generates about 600 BTU of body heat, which must be considered in the cooling calculation.
Q3: What if my room has high ceilings?
A: For ceilings over 8 feet, add 10% more BTU for every additional foot of ceiling height.
Q4: Does room orientation matter?
A: South-facing rooms may need 10-15% more cooling capacity due to increased sun exposure.
Q5: Should I round up the calculated BTU?
A: Yes, it's recommended to round up to the nearest available unit size for optimal performance.
